Well, truth be told, the RAV4 is more like an All Wheel Drive vehicle than dedicated 4x4. My opinion is the demonstration shows more that it can handle a semi rough road at good speed for the type of vehicle it is. Your comment though reminds me of when I went Mt Biking in Oregon and asked about the access road to one of their 6000' elevation trails. The ranger looked at me after seeing that I drove up in a 79 Corolla, and says, "That road has not been maintained since the 20's, we only recommend high clearance 4 wheel drives on it."

Well me and my Mt Biking spirit just got all the hungrier to get up there and camp and ride that trail, so there I went. I made it all the way up and down, just had to go pretty slow and carefully place my wheels high on the rut ridges. I did bang a slight dent in the gas tank at one point, but it was well worth it.
